RX Vega 64 with i7-7700K benchmarks at High Quality settings
It is worth noting that the RX Vega 64 is a very power hungry card and requires a decent power supply unit. In terms of memory, the RX Vega 64 's 8192 MB RAM is more than enough for modern games and should not cause any bottlenecks. It is important to know that RX Vega 64 's max load temperature is very high and might require custom cooling solutions. In short the performance is exceptional, there's no question that this is one of the most powerful single GPU out there in 2017 .
AMD ’s xx64 cards have always been defined by high-end prices with performance that knocks on the door of extreme graphics cards – especially when overclocked. After taking the time to fully test the GCN 5.0 graphics card inside the RX Vega 64, we can say without a doubt that it continues the trend. For 1080p Full HD, we were able to play Borderlands 3, Anthem, Need For Speed: Heat, Final Fantasy XV, Just Cause 4 at 65 fps to 81 fps and kept frame rates hovering around 74 fps.

For 1440p Quad HD, we were able to play Shadow of the Tomb Raider, Monster Hunter: World, GreedFall, Hitman 2, F1 2019 at 61 fps to 73 fps and kept frame rates hovering around 66 fps. For 2160p 4K, we were able to play F1 2018 at 61 fps to 61 fps and kept frame rates hovering around 61 fps.

The Radeon RX Vega 64 is a high-end graphics card by AMD, launched in August 2017. Built on the 14 nm process, and based on the Vega 10 graphics processor, in its Vega 10 XT variant, the card supports DirectX 12.0.
